Viridian Therapeutics reported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of -$0.90, beating the consensus estimate of -$1.12 by 19.37%. The company, which has no approved products, reported zero revenue for the quarter. Despite the earnings beat, shares fell approximately 2.54% in aftermarket trading as investors weighed ongoing clinical and operational developments.

Viridian Therapeutics remains a pre-revenue clinical-stage biotech, with all spending directed toward research and development. During Q1 2026, the company’s net loss of roughly $0.90 per share was narrower than analysts had modeled, reflecting disciplined operating expenses. The improved EPS likely stems from lower-than-expected R&D and G&A costs, though management has not yet detailed specific line items. The company’s primary focus is advancing its portfolio of therapies for thyroid eye disease (TED), including VRDN-001 and VRDN-003. In the quarter, Viridian continued to enroll and dose patients in its Phase 3 registrational trials, with key data readouts expected later in 2026. No major safety signals or operational setbacks were disclosed. Cash burn and runway remain critical metrics for investors; the company ended the quarter with sufficient capital to fund operations into mid-2027, based on cash and equivalents reported in prior filings. No segment performance details are available, as Viridian operates as a single development-stage entity.

However, management may have reiterated its expectations for near-term phase 3 data releases. The company anticipates reporting top-line results from its pivotal trial of VRDN-001 in TED before the end of 2026. Positive data could support a Biologics License Application (BLA) submission, potentially leading to Viridian’s first commercial product launch. On the regulatory front, Viridian has previously received breakthrough therapy designation for VRDN-001 from the FDA, which could expedite review. Risks include potential enrollment delays, unexpected safety issues, or competitive developments from other TED therapies. The company also continues to advance VRDN-003, an extended-release formulation, though no clinical updates were provided for Q1. Cash management will be crucial to sustain operations through critical milestones without further dilution. No adjustments to prior full-year expenditure forecasts were mentioned.

The 2.54% decline in Viridian’s stock following the Q1 report suggests a muted reaction, possibly because the EPS beat was largely anticipated and the fundamental story remains dependent on future data. Analysts covering the stock have focused on the upcoming phase 3 results as the primary catalyst. The narrower loss may provide a modest cushion for the share price, but near-term volatility is likely tied to clinical trial updates rather than quarterly financial performance. Investment implications hinge on the strength of the top-line data from the VRDN-001 trial, which could either validate the drug’s commercial potential or introduce uncertainty. Key items to watch in the next quarters include: the timing and magnitude of the phase 3 readout, any partnership or licensing announcements, cash runway updates, and competitive moves from fellow TED developers like Horizon Therapeutics (Amgen). For now, the Q1 report offers a slightly improved financial profile but no change to the binary risk inherent in a pre-commercial biotech.
